### Account Recovery — Catalogue Import (Lintwood)

Quick one for review: when the Lintwood catalogue import wipes a patron's session table, the recovery flow re-seeds accounts from the nightly snapshot. Check that the importer skips locked accounts — last time it didn't. To rerun recovery against staging you'll need the vault passphrase, which is appended just below.

recovery phrase for yafof-tajof: julmir-kelax-julvan-holath-belvan-holir-ralael-ralvan-ralath-julvan-silmir-istmir-kaswyn-ulamir

// Context for new folks: last quarter's stale-cache incident on Pindle
// happened because this client silently fell back to cached reads when
// auth failed. Postmortem action item: fail loudly, never serve stale.
// This client now requires a valid credential at startup or it aborts.
// The internal cache-bus key it expects is the following.

API key for baduf-kajof: qvz15-lhy9b0ZlYh1xyJw

Shrinklet, the batch image resizing CLI from Tarnwick Labs, runs against three environments: sandbox, staging, and production. Plugin authors should develop exclusively against sandbox, which resets nightly and enforces the same quota rules as production. Staging mirrors production data shapes but tolerates experimental codecs. Resolution limits, concurrency caps, and output format defaults differ per environment, so always verify before publishing a plugin. The sandbox environment currently ships with these configuration values:

config for yajep-tafof:
[rusath]
team = julmir
access_code = ac_fe37fd
host = rusath.novactech.test
port = 8000
owner = pelmir.weneth
peer = oliwyn.olvarqdyn.internal

# Service Accounts — Spinshift Rebalancer

The Spinshift rebalancing tool runs under the `sa-spinshift-rebal` account. It reads dock occupancy from Dockline and writes move orders to the Haulplan queue. Review any PR that widens its scope; it must stay read-only on Dockline. Local test runs use the staging account only, never production. For integration tests against the staging Haulplan endpoint, use the key below.

gateway credential: kto3_qfe